Shanghai Bund : Located along the Huangpu River, this area impresses with its classic European-style architectural buildings from the early 20th century. This place not only attracts tourists with its brilliant urban landscape but is also the gathering place for many cultural events, art performances, fairs, etc. Visitors can take a cruise on the Huangpu River in the evening to see the whole view of the Shanghai Bund with its brilliant lights.
Nanjing Avenue : The busiest street in Shanghai with hundreds of shops from luxury brands to traditional small shops, along with countless unique restaurants and cafes. When the city lights up, visitors can feel the rhythm of a sleepless Shanghai.

Oriental Pearl TV Tower : Considered a symbol of Shanghai with its unique architecture, harmoniously combining two styles of futurism and aesthetics. With a height of 468m, this is a bustling complex including a radio station, shopping mall and restaurants.
Shanghai World Financial Center : A testament to the city’s strong economic development. The 101-story tower has a unique “beer opener” design. The observatory on the 100th floor offers a view of the city and the poetic Huangpu River from the transparent glass floor below.

Signature dishes
Xiao Long Bao : The small dumplings filled with rich broth, silky-thin skin and soft meat filling are a culinary icon not to be missed when visiting Shanghai.
Steamed Hairy Crab : With a firm shell, sweet and fragrant meat and rich golden fat, this dish offers an unforgettable culinary experience.
Spicy and sour fish soup : A rich dish that perfectly combines the sour and spicy taste of unique spices and the natural sweetness of fresh fish.
Schedule
Day 1 : Take your time to fully appreciate the ancient beauty and classical architecture of the Bund and enjoy hairy crab noodles for lunch at Cejerdary restaurant. Shop, experience street food and stroll Nanjing walking street in the afternoon and evening.
Day 2 : Visit the Oriental Pearl Tower and Jin Mao Tower – two modern symbols of Shanghai with the opportunity to admire the entire city from an impressive height.
Day 3 : Spend the day exploring Shanghai Disneyland, enjoying exciting games, visiting fairytale castles and spectacular fireworks displays at 6:30 p.m. every day.
Day 4 : Explore Zhujiajiao, an ancient town famous for its canal system, ancient architecture and traditional boat ride experience; enjoy local specialties such as sticky rice cakes, fresh fish and stinky tofu at riverside eateries, full of the flavor of old Shanghai.
Day 5 : Admire unique historical artifacts at the Shanghai Museum. Enjoy shopping at the IFC Mall, a shopping paradise with the world's leading luxury brands. Enjoy the famous Xiao Long Bao at Din Tai Fung restaurant.
Day 6 : Visit Tan Thien Dia in the morning, stroll around the ancient and modern quarter with unique cafes and restaurants. Continue the journey to Yu Garden, admire the traditional ancient garden and enjoy local dishes at the nearby food market. In the afternoon, visit the Jade Buddha Temple to admire the Jade Buddha statue, considered a priceless treasure.
